FAQs

Australian audiences can anticipate "Braveheart" to deliver large-scale, visceral battle sequences. The film is known for its unsparing depiction of medieval warfare, featuring extensive use of kilts, swords, and the famed Scottish charge. While the historical accuracy of certain tactics is debated, the sheer scale and intensity of the combat are designed to be overwhelming and immersive. Expect a raw, often brutal, but undeniably spectacular portrayal of conflict that underscores the ferocity of the Scottish struggle.
